Stránka 2 z 2

Re: GPIO switch podmínka pro zapnutí

Napsal: 24. leden 2023, 12:00
od puls
Dekuji, ted se deje to,ze se to samo zapina bez ohledu na stav senzoru, nema vi jestli je true nebo false, vzdy se to samo sepne :(

Re: GPIO switch podmínka pro zapnutí

Napsal: 24. leden 2023, 13:03
od puls
aktualne to mam ve funkcni stavu co se tyka hardwaru, ale jeste nevim proc po nizke hladine (sensor false) a sepnuti switche mi zustane na panelu sviti switch jako zapnuty i kdyz hardwarove je vypnuty jak ocekavam. Jakoby se neaktualizoval stav.

Obrázek

Kód: Vybrat vše

binary_sensor:
  - platform: gpio
    name: "hladina"
    id: hladina
    pin: 
      number: GPIO14
    on_release:
      - switch.turn_off: relay_pump

switch:
  ## relay pump
  - platform: gpio
    pin: GPIO5
    name: "Relay pump"  
    id: relay_pump
    on_turn_on:
      then:
        - if:
            condition:
              lambda: 'return id(hladina).state == true;'
            then:
              - switch.turn_on: relay_pump
            else:
              - switch.turn_off: relay_pump
    on_turn_off:
      - switch.turn_off: relay_pump